Small Heath Station offers essential services to facilitate your journey. The ticket office operates on weekdays from 07:00 to 10:00, ensuring you can grab a last-minute ticket or seek help if needed.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available, and you can collect tickets purchased online here too. It's worth noting that while the station is fitted with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, it lacks step-free access—a crucial point for travelers with mobility needs.
Even though Small Heath Station doesn't have a waiting room, there are seating areas to ensure comfort while you wait. Additionally, CCTV coverage throughout the station helps in ensuring passenger security. While there are no refreshment facilities or shops here, the vibrancy of Birmingham ensures you'll find plenty of those in the vicinity.
Small Heath's connectivity spans beyond trains, with various travel options available. Rail replacement services, when required, operate from the front of the station, making it easy for passengers to switch travel modes without a hitch. Taxis are readily available with local services like Heartlands and Silverline offering convenient pick-up and drop-off options. For the eco-conscious or budget traveler, local bus services provide an excellent way to navigate Birmingham's sights and sounds.

While Cardiff Bay Train Station may not boast extensive amenities, it does efficiently cover the key necessities for travelers. You won't find a ticket office but don’t fret! Ticket machines are there to facilitate collection of pre-purchased tickets, accept both cash and cards, and are accessible for all travelers, including those who use wheelchairs. Notably, the station provides step-free access from Bute Street and Lloyd George Avenue, maintaining its 'Category A' accessibility status.
For those curious about smart travel, Cardiff Bay does not issue smartcards, but validators are available for use. And should you need assistance, a help point is there, alongside departure and arrival screens, ensuring you’re kept in the loop about train statuses. Be sure to take advantage of the assistance service, which permits bookings up to two hours before your trip starts. Whenever needed, contacting the Transport for Wales Customer Relations team is a few clicks away.
Effortlessly commute in and out of Cardiff Bay with the station’s array of transport links. A strategically placed rail replacement bus stop awaits on Bute Street, and bus services are conveniently available right outside the station. If you fancy cycling over public transport, Nextbike/Ovo bike sharing has you covered, with docking stations ready at Lloyd George Avenue for exploring the city on two wheels.
